Description
The Book of Joe Podcast begins with the Astros closing out a World Series win. Hosts Tom Verducci and World Series Champion Joe Maddon discuss Houston being one of the best teams all season. Yordan Alvarez was really impressive all season and the pitching came through in all aspects. With the amount of strikeouts the Astros pitching got, it didn't leave many balls in play for a defense that was still spectacular. Joe thinks this win will push teams, especially in the AL West, to try and create a hitting lineup that can move the ball around the field. Dusty Baker finally gets his World Series championship after 25 years of managing. Dusty has had the right demeanor to last so long in the game and had the perfect mentality to calm the situation and bring credibility back to Houston. As for the game itself, Tom was surprised to see the Phillies mood just tank when they were down. We find out the one pivotal moment that changed the outcome. The 118th World Series was entertaining and both teams represented the game well. We wrap up with music heard in Baker's office through the series. Joe thinks the season should end with ZZ Top and 'Sharp Dressed Man' for Baker's upcoming offseason.
